Adjective[edit]

focused (comparative more focused, superlative most focused)

  1. Directing all one's efforts towards achieving a particular goal.
  2. Dealing with some narrowly defined aspects of a broader phenomenon.

Synonyms[edit]

Antonyms[edit]

  • (antonym(s) of directing all one's efforts towards a goal): distracted
  • (antonym(s) of dealing with narrow aspects): broad, unfocused
